Seattle Mariners vs Baltimore Orioles Preview and Analysis
The Mariners are entering this series off a loss and lost their 3-game series against the Detroit Tigers 2-1 in their last series. They enter this game with a 34-32 record overall and have a road record of 15-16. This is the 2nd game of a 4-game series with the Orioles on Tuesday with the series opener still to be played on Monday. Their offense ranks 11th in the MLB with a .718 OPS. Emerson Hancock is their starting pitcher on Monday while Logan Gilbert is making his start in this game on Tuesday. He is 4-4 with a 3.79 ERA this season. His team won their last 3 straight games this season with him making an appearance. In his last MLB regular season appearance, he allowed 3 ER, 2 HR, and 1 BB with 8 SO on 4 hits through 5.1 IP against the New York Mets.
The Orioles are entering this series off a loss and lost their 3-game series against the Toronto Blue Jays 2-1 in their last series. They enter this game with a 31-35 record overall and have a home record of 19-15. This is the 2nd game of a 4-game series with the Mariners on Tuesday with the 1st game of this series still to be played on Monday. Their offense ranks 8th in the MLB with a .722 OPS. Rookie pitcher Trey Gibson is their starting pitcher on Monday while Trevor Rogers is making his start in this game on Tuesday. He is 3-6 with a 6.29 ERA this season. His team lost 7 of their last 8 games this season with him making an appearance. In his last MLB regular season start, he allowed 1 earned run, 0 homers, and 1 walk with 3 strikeouts on 5 hits through 5.2 innings pitched against the Boston Red Sox.
Mariners vs Orioles Prediction
The current betting odds have the Mariners listed as a slight favorite in this game according to Draftkings Sportsbook. The Mariners have looked good in their games this season with their 34-32 record overall which has them right at the top of the AL West. They haven't been a great road team though with their 15-16 road record this year. Meanwhile, the Orioles haven't looked great in their games this season with their 31-35 record overall which has them right near the bottom of the AL East. They have looked a lot better in their own ballpark though with their 19-15 home record this season. The Orioles have had a lot of trouble all season and they are only 5-5 in their last 10 games, giving up a ton of runs too. The Mariners had a terrible start to the season, but they have turned things around and are now 7-3 in their last 10 games, leading their division too. Both offenses have looked pretty good lately, but the Mariners do have the better pitching matchup in this one and they can take advantage of that. The Mariners are going with Gilbert in this one and he has looked good this season. He is 4-4 with a 3.79 ERA and his team has had a ton of success with him this year. He did give up 3 earned runs in his last start, but he has looked a lot better lately and the team has won 3 games in a row now with him starting. The Orioles are going with Rogers in this one and he hasn't looked great this season. He is 3-6 with a 6.29 ERA and his team has had a lot of trouble with him this year. They have lost 7 of their last 8 games with him starting and he has been giving up a ton of runs all season. He is off a great start in which he only gave up 1 earned run, but that hasn't been a common theme for him and the Mariners are going to put up runs with their offense being really hot over the last week. Look for the Mariners to bounce back from that series loss to the Tigers and get themselves back on track in this series. The best way to place a bet here is on the Mariners to win this game.
Mariners Orioles Prediction: Our MLB Pick for Tuesday, June 9, 2026 (6:35 pm ET start time) is Mariners 7 Orioles 4.
